Tasting Notes

AI-generated sensory profile for Crafty Devil Porter

Appearance

Deep brown to near-black in the glass, with a opacity that reveals only a thin rim of amber when held to light. The head is thick and tan-colored, settling into fine Schaumkleiden that cling persistently to the glass walls. Carbonation is moderate and well-integrated, creating a dense, stable foam structure.

deep brownopaquefine lacingcreamy head

Aroma

Roasted malt dominates immediately, with a coffee-forward character that evokes freshly ground dark roast beans. Cocoa and chocolate notes emerge beneath, joined by subtle dark fruit undertones—dried plum and blackcurrant—while a gentle herbal bitterness frames the nose without overpowering.

roasted maltcoffeecocoadark fruit

Taste

The palate arrives smooth and full-bodied, with roasted grain and coffee providing the core structure. Chocolate and cocoa develop mid-palate, blending seamlessly with hints of dried fruit, while the bitterness remains restrained at 25 IBU—present but never harsh. The malt backbone carries the beer through without astringency, leaving a clean, dry impression.

coffee-forwardchocolatesmoothdry finish

Finish

The finish is medium in length with a lingering roasted and slightly bitter aftertaste. Warmth from the modest 5.2% ABV fades cleanly, allowing the coffee and cocoa notes to persist gently without becoming cloying.

What is a Porter?

Porters are dark ales with 4–6.5% ABV and IBU 18–35. Roasted malt brings chocolate, caramel and toffee — medium body with a clean finish.
